Outline of Final Research Achievements |
A new experimental development for low-energy ion-neutral reaction has been carried out. The research aims to study the ion-neutral reaction dynamics in upper atmosphere and interstellar spaces. The low-energy collision experiment will be realized by merging a molecular ion beam and neutral beam in a cryogenic ion storage ring RICE at RIKEN. The following apparatus/technique has been developed; 1. generation and transport of negative ion beam, 2. neutralization of the negative ion beam, and 3. injection and storage of moleclar ion beam in RICE. Before the final year, the project was finished and reconstructed to be another KAKENHI project.
